Which is the characteristic of a line?

A characteristic of a line is that it is straight and extends infinitely in both directions without any curvature. It has no thickness or width, only length. Additionally, a line is determined by two points, and it can be represented mathematically by a linear equation in a coordinate system.

Why the shape of AC CURVE is U shaped?

The Average Cost (AC) curve is U-shaped due to the relationship between fixed and variable costs as production levels change. Initially, as output increases, average costs decline due to the spreading of fixed costs over more units and increasing efficiency through economies of scale. However, after reaching an optimal production level, average costs begin to rise as diminishing returns set in, leading to higher variable costs for additional units. This combination of decreasing and then increasing costs results in the U-shaped appearance of the AC curve.

What do you call lines that join places of the same height?

Lines that join places of the same height are called contour lines. These lines are often used in topographic maps to represent elevation and terrain features. Each contour line indicates a specific elevation level, and the spacing between the lines can indicate the steepness of the terrain.

Where are the reflected angles measured from?

Reflected angles are measured from the normal line, which is an imaginary line that is perpendicular to the surface at the point of incidence. When light or another wave hits a surface, the angle of incidence is the angle between the incoming ray and the normal, while the angle of reflection is the angle between the reflected ray and the normal. According to the law of reflection, these two angles are equal.

What angel measures between 90 and 180 degrees?

An angle that measures between 90 and 180 degrees is called an obtuse angle. Such angles are larger than a right angle but smaller than a straight angle. Examples of obtuse angles include 120 degrees and 150 degrees.

What term best describes the first particles of a crystal that form three dimensional pattern?

The term that best describes the first particles of a crystal that form a three-dimensional pattern is "nucleus" or "nucleation." Nucleation refers to the initial process where atoms or molecules begin to arrange themselves into a stable structure, leading to the growth of a crystal. This process is crucial in crystallization, as it establishes the framework for the subsequent growth of the crystal lattice.

When postulate or theorem verifies the congruence of these triangles?

The congruence of triangles can be verified using several postulates and theorems, including the Side-Side-Side (SSS) postulate, which states that if three sides of one triangle are equal to three sides of another triangle, the triangles are congruent. Another is the Side-Angle-Side (SAS) theorem, which asserts that if two sides and the included angle of one triangle are equal to two sides and the included angle of another triangle, the triangles are congruent. Additionally, the Angle-Side-Angle (ASA) theorem and the Angle-Angle-Side (AAS) theorem also confirm triangle congruence based on specific angle and side relationships.
